Apologies, my post wasn't as clear as it should have been. The question that was posed was if VT needed all of their trains to be 11-coaches long. And my answer was no, they don't
need all of their trains to be 11-coaches because there are some services which aren't full. Indeed there are some services where even a nine-coach train is overkill. Not to mention the fact that loadings vary along the route.
However, since some of their services need 11-coaches, it would be sensible to make all of their trains 11-coaches since the marginal cost of running a couple of extra coaches on services where they aren't required is more than offset by the potential losses caused by only having 9 coaches where 11 are required and the operational flexibility that a uniform fleet provides. This also caters for potential growth.
